Job Description:
The Associate Director, Clinical development will work in a project team environment on late phase clinical trials of a novel therapeutic for a neurodegenerative disease indication. Internally, s/he will interface directly with clinical operations, regulatory affairs, biometrics, medical affairs, and other physicians within clinical development to ensure proper design, monitoring, and oversight of clinical trials. Externally, s/he will be a liaison to investigators and key opinion leaders and participate in reporting and presenting clinical trial data.
Principal Duties and Responsibilities:
· Serving as medical monitor with primary responsibility for patient safety and conduct of assigned trials as well as overall data and safety surveillance
· Addressing and resolving medical/safety/eligibility questions from participating clinical trial sites
· Participating in the planning and management of investigator meetings, advisory boards and other scientific committees
· Providing strategic input into clinical/regulatory development plans
· Writing/reviewing clinical trial protocols, study reports, and international regulatory documents
· Participating in the selection and management of contract research organizations (CROs) and other vendors
· Collaborating with pre-clinical and translational medicine colleagues in assessing the potential of new compounds for development
